Latest Patents

Günter Steinbach holds a patent for a drafting frame for a spinning machine. This invention features a sliver compactor positioned between a drafting roller and the delivery unit that supplies sliver to the spinning stations. The sliver compactor includes a shielding element that reduces the suction force needed to draw fibers into a compact form. This design enhances the overall performance of the spinning machine.
